Gov. Schwarzenegger’s May Revision of the state budget continues to include the proposed restoration of $305 million to the California State University’s 2010-11 budget, plus $60.6 million to support enrollment growth across the CSU’s 23 campuses.

“Gov. Schwarzenegger has made supporting higher education a priority and we appreciate the continued commitment of his administration,” said CSU Chancellor Charles B. Reed.

“The return of these funds will allow us to restore and preserve student access at campuses across the state,” Reed added. “By reinvesting in California’s public universities, we will all ultimately benefit from the creation of jobs which is vital to the state’s economic recovery and prosperity.”
